The 1911 Chinese Revolution ended the rule of the _____? -manchus -qing -song -mongolians
nata0808 [166]
<span>The answer was the Qing.  It was also known as the Xinhai Revolution that led to the removal of the Qing Dynasty and the founding of the Republic of China.  The cause of the Revolution was due to the failure of the Qing to modernize the country.  This began a series of revolts in the country. The Revolution ended when the last emperor Puyi stepped down from the throne on February 12, 1912 and this ended 2,000 years of Imperial rule and the beginning of China’s Republican Era.</span>

What led to theIncrease in successful Independence movements in Africa and Asia fallen world war 2
Andreyy89
The reasons why decolonization took place are many and complex, varying widely from one country to another. Three key elements played a major role in the process: colonized peoples' thirst for independence, the Second World War which demonstrated that colonial powers were no longer invulnerable, and a new focus on anti-colonialism in international arenas such as the United Nations.
